The Marinervídeo

My 2800Nm Solo Transatlantic Voyage Begins!

31 de março de 2026 · 11 min · 4K visualizações · Cherbourg

O que este vídeo aborda

Chris departs Cherbourg solo aboard Osprey on a 2,800-nautical-mile transatlantic passage — his 37th transatlantic crossing.0:03 He motors out of the harbor at sunset, timing the departure to ride the ebb tide out of the English Channel.0:52 Pre-departure preparation included a full rig inspection to the third spreader, checking all diagonals, the mast, halyards, reef lines, and stowing the dinghy aboard.1:20 He powers up the Raymarine autopilot and navigation instruments dockside, noting the absence of a Windex as the only outstanding issue.11:14 Chris flags the risk of complacency on experienced passages, framing it as a second "mount stupid" that builds quietly after many uneventful crossings.0:33 Upcoming plans disclosed: crew berths available on the Newport Bermuda Race aboard Osprey (roughly a 10-day event from the 16th to the 27th), followed by a Bermuda-to-Plymouth transatlantic in the second week of August targeting Richard Tolkien's Hamilton-to-Plymouth record.10:33
